What “Cheap Website Traffic” Really Means
For experienced advertisers, cheap doesn’t mean buying the lowest-priced traffic available. It means paying less for every visitor while still generating measurable business results.
The true value of any traffic source isn’t determined by its CPM or CPC alone. What matters is how efficiently that traffic converts into the actions that drive your business—whether that’s purchases, registrations, app installs, subscriptions, or qualified leads.
That’s why successful media buyers evaluate traffic using performance metrics like:
- Cost per acquisition (CPA)
- Return on ad spend (ROAS)
- Conversion rate
- Customer lifetime value (LTV)
- Revenue per visitor
A campaign with a slightly higher CPM can easily outperform a cheaper alternative if it consistently delivers stronger conversion rates. Likewise, traffic that costs next to nothing may become expensive if visitors leave immediately or never engage with your offer.

Main Sources for Buying Cheap Website Traffic: Honest Comparison
Advertisers have no shortage of options when looking to buy website traffic cheap, but every traffic source comes with its own balance of cost, scale, user intent, and optimization opportunities.
Some formats excel at reaching large audiences quickly, while others prioritize engagement or high purchase intent. Choosing the right one depends on your campaign objectives, target audience, and performance goals—not simply on which platform offers the lowest bid.
Here’s how the most common traffic sources compare.
| Traffic Source | Cost | Best For | Key Strength | Things to Consider |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Popunder Ads | Low CPM | Scaling campaigns, affiliate marketing, landing page testing | High traffic volumes with minimal setup | Lower user intent than search traffic |
| Push Notifications | Low–Medium CPC | Promotions, apps, subscriptions, ecommerce | Strong engagement and flexible targeting | Performance depends on creative freshness |
| Native Advertising | Medium | Content marketing, lead generation, ecommerce | Contextual placements with engaged audiences | Requires quality creatives and ongoing optimization |
| Display Advertising | Medium | Brand awareness, remarketing | Broad reach across premium publishers | Banner fatigue may impact CTR |
| Search Advertising | High CPC | High-intent customer acquisition | Excellent conversion potential | Highly competitive and often expensive |
| Low-Cost Traffic Packages | Very Low | Vanity metrics | Extremely inexpensive | Frequently associated with poor-quality or invalid traffic |
Among these options, Popunder and Push advertising continue to offer one of the strongest combinations of affordability, scalability, and campaign flexibility. Both formats allow advertisers to generate significant traffic volumes without the creative costs or bidding pressure often associated with search and native advertising.
That doesn’t mean they’re always the right choice. Native advertising may generate more engaged visitors for content-driven campaigns, while search ads often outperform other channels when purchase intent is the priority.
Experienced advertisers rarely depend on a single acquisition channel. Instead, they diversify traffic sources, monitor campaign performance closely, and allocate budgets toward the formats that consistently deliver the best return.

Popunder and Push Ads: The Go-To for Volume on a Budget
When the objective is to drive large volumes of traffic while keeping acquisition costs low, Popunder and Push ads remain two of the most effective options available. Both formats are widely used by performance marketers because they combine affordable pricing with the ability to scale campaigns quickly across multiple GEOs.
Popunder Ads: Built for Fast Testing and Scalable Growth
Popunder campaigns are particularly attractive when speed and volume matter. Since users are taken directly to your landing page after interacting with a publisher’s website, advertisers can generate substantial traffic without relying on banners, videos, or complex creative production.
This makes Popunder advertising a practical choice for:
- Launching new campaigns
- Testing landing pages and offers
- Scaling affiliate marketing funnels
- Driving software downloads
- Promoting subscription-based services
Another advantage is simplicity. To buy cheap traffic for website campaigns with Popunder ads, you typically only need a destination URL, campaign settings, and your targeting preferences. Without the need to continuously refresh creatives, advertisers can launch campaigns faster and focus on optimization instead.
Push Ads: Affordable Traffic with Higher Engagement
Push notifications offer a different path to affordable traffic acquisition. Delivered to users who have opted in to receive browser notifications, they often attract more engaged audiences than traditional display ads while remaining significantly more affordable than search advertising.
Push campaigns perform particularly well for:
- Ecommerce promotions
- Mobile apps
- Finance offers
- Sweepstakes
- Seasonal campaigns
- Content distribution
Modern ad networks also provide granular targeting by GEO, device, operating system, browser, language, and connection type, allowing advertisers to refine campaigns as performance data accumulates. Rather than treating these formats as competitors, many advertisers combine both. Popunder campaigns generate the scale needed to test and grow quickly, while Push campaigns help capture users with stronger engagement signals.

The Biggest Risks of Cheap Traffic And How to Avoid Getting Burned
Affordable traffic should reduce your acquisition costs—not your campaign performance. One of the biggest misconceptions in digital advertising is that low-priced traffic is inherently risky. In reality, the biggest risk comes from buying traffic without visibility into its quality or performance.
Here are the most common mistakes advertisers should avoid.
Chasing the Lowest Price
Traffic that seems incredibly cheap often becomes the most expensive if it generates impressions instead of conversions. Always evaluate traffic against your CPA and ROAS goals rather than CPM alone.
Ignoring Traffic Quality
Not every provider offers the same level of inventory quality. Reputable advertising platforms invest in fraud detection, publisher verification, and traffic monitoring to help advertisers minimize invalid traffic and protect their budgets.
Limited Reporting and Optimization
Without detailed analytics, it’s difficult to understand which placements are driving results. Choose platforms that allow you to monitor campaign performance, optimize traffic sources, and adjust targeting based on real conversion data.

Tracking, Optimization, and Scaling Without Wasting Money
Launching a campaign is only the beginning. Whether you buy traffic to website campaigns for lead generation, ecommerce, affiliate marketing, or app promotion, tracking every important metric is essential for improving performance and controlling costs.
Start by implementing reliable conversion tracking before your campaign goes live. This gives you a clear understanding of which traffic sources, placements, devices, and GEOs are generating real business value rather than simply producing clicks or impressions.
As performance data accumulates, focus on gradual optimization:
- Exclude placements that consistently underperform.
- Increase bids on traffic sources delivering strong ROI.
- Refine targeting by GEO, device, operating system, browser, or connection type.
- Test different landing pages and offers to improve conversion rates.
- Allocate more budget to your highest-performing campaigns while pausing those that fail to meet your CPA goals.
Scaling should always be driven by performance—not by budget alone. Increasing spend too quickly can introduce less efficient inventory and reduce overall profitability. Instead, expand campaigns incrementally while monitoring key metrics like conversion rate, CPA, ROAS, and customer value.
Experienced media buyers also diversify their acquisition strategy. Rather than relying on a single traffic format, they combine channels such as Popunder, Push, Native, Display, or Social Bar to reach users at different stages of the customer journey. This approach not only creates more stable performance but also reduces dependence on any one source.
